Admissions process
- 1
Application
This is the first level of screening. This phase determines whether the applicants are eligible to apply for the course or not based on their demographics.
- 2
Literacy Test
This phase determines/assesses student competencies with respect to comprehending simple sentences and very short simple social conversations through MCQ based questions (to check their listening & reading skill)
- 3
Fire in the Belly Test/ Pre-work
In this, learners are assessed on persistence, future orientation & personal responsibility.
- 4
Interview
In this, learners are assessed on the communication skill, professionalism, motivational fit and program fit.
- 5
Decision
You will be notified via email once a decision has been made regarding your admission and next steps.
Skills Earned
Technical Skills
We'll help you learn the technical skills with lots of hands-on, interactive sessions. By the end, you'll know:
- Basics of anatomy and physiology
- Common diseases and universal precautions
- General surgical and medical instruments
- Sterilization procedures
- Patient hygiene
- Patient transport and positioning
- Feeding a patient
- Bed pan
